Note: A major flood
destroyed all records in the Kinney County courthouse on June 14, 1899. It is likely that GAR records were
destroyed in this event. |

"A box full of the records, along with miscellaneous
publications of the National and State headquarters, several letters, and
even a couple of medals worn by members of the GAR." The collection was discovered in a box, and
almost every item in it had been shreaded or torn. The contents of the collection were
described by Dayton Kelley (Mary Hardin-Baylor College) in an article in the
Waco Tribune-Herald, 29 Jan. 1967, pg. 8C. |
